Finisar compatible FTLC1154RDPLC Description

EdgeOptic's FTLC1154RDPLC compatible is a Finisar/Coherent-coded 100GBASE-LR4 QSFP28 transceiver built on the EdgeOptic 100G-QSFP28-10 platform. Finisar was acquired by II-VI Incorporated in 2019 and rebranded as Coherent Corp in 2022, so the same module family appears in current procurement under both Finisar and Coherent branding. The EdgeOptic compatible covers the FTLC1154RDPLC ordering code; confirm the exact ordering reference and variant scope with Coherent before raising a purchase order. The module slots into a standard QSFP28 cage and follows the same insertion, hot-swap, and DDM behavior as the OEM module.

The optical interface follows IEEE 802.3ba Clause 88 100GBASE-LR4. Four 25.78 Gbps NRZ lanes ride the LAN WDM grid at 1295.56, 1300.05, 1304.58, and 1309.14 nm, then multiplex onto a single LC duplex pair of single-mode fiber. The 6.3 dB optical path loss budget supports a full 10 km reach on G.652 SMF. Power dissipation stays at 3.5 W on a single 3.3 V supply, the operating temperature window is 0 to 70 C commercial, and the module reports DDM telemetry per SFF-8636 for tx power, rx power, bias current, supply voltage, and case temperature.

EdgeOptic's compatible matches the original optical and electrical specifications and carries the FTLC1154RDPLC ordering code so procurement records and chassis inventory output stay consistent with the part number called out in the equipment configuration. The compatible carries Class 1 laser safety classification, RoHS compliance, and CE marking. Typical deployment scenarios include ISP aggregation and backbone uplinks, mobile operator core and backhaul links, and data center site interconnects on QSFP28 hosts that accept third-party 100GBASE-LR4 optics per the QSFP28 MSA.
